Inside Out and Back Again will be used as a partner text with Out of the Dust when we cover RL.7.2, RL.7.3 and RL.7.5. It will be a great addition to the unit. More individual items, like highlighters and erasers, will keep students safe so they do not have to share materials while we do our work. Finally, the lamps and frames will be used to make the environment more comfortable and welcoming. Inside the frames will be posters highlighting famous artists from diverse backgrounds and ethnicities. The goal is to have all students see a person that looks like them on the walls. The goal is also to begin to provide flexible options in the space. The stand up desk and white board materials (I already have a set of whiteboards) will allow for students to move away from their traditional desk and find other alternatives for preferred seating.
